Description (What the record is about)
-
The Manour of Nunney belonging to James Theobald Esqr.
26.6" to 1m. O.S. 42 NE
43 NW, SW
The map covers most of the northern half of the parish as far as The Catch, with scattered holdings south of the 'Rudge Way' as far as 'Voganshire'[Fogamshire on O.S.]at Trudoxhill. Names of lanes and adjacent owners; strips in Nunney Field. Large scale drawing of the Castle in perspective view. Map distinguishes intermixed freeholds by colour and intermixed freehold houses by shading. No book of reference.
